Power Supply Solution

The development kit can be powered from an ATX power supply (desktop solution) that
contains all of the voltage regulators necessary to power the system up. Additionally,
battery or AC adapter support is provided through +12VDC input.
The characteristic of using AC adapter or battery pack is slightly different from using an
ATX power supply:
• Due to the low current rating of the AC adapter, the carrier board does not support
a full load of extension slots (SDVO, 2 PCIe* and PCI slots). When using these
extension slots, please use an ATX power supply.
• In the case of using the AC adapter, it is recommended that the carrier board be
connected to the LVDS LCD module and an external 2.5" hard disk only. When
using AC adapter, please supply power to the hard disk using the power supply
connector (X48) on the carrier board. If using the X48 connector, the customer
must prepare a hard disk power cable that converts to the adaptive connector.
• Using the AC adapter is allowed as long as the total of the system current
consumption is not beyond the rating output of the used AC adapter. Please use
available AC adapter that has the rating output of 6.5A or less.
Note:
Use an UL94V-1 minimum compliant AC adapter that provides 80 Watts of continuous
output power. For example, the Sinpro Electronics Model No. SPU80-105* meets this
requirement.
Use an ATX12V 1.1 specification compliant power supply regardless of maker or
wattage level (an ATX12V rating means V5 min current =0.1 A vs. an ATX V5 min
current = 1.0 A, among other differences). For example, the Sparkle* Model No.
FSP300-60BTV meets this requirement and is an ATX12V 1.1 specification compliant
power supply.
If the power switch on the ATX power supply is used to shut down the system, wait at
least 5 seconds before turning the system on again.
The recommended way to shut down the board is through software or by pressing and
holding the power button switch (SW5) for 5 seconds until the power supply turns off.
Using the power supply switch or pulling the plug out of the wall is not recommended.

Board Size

The form factor of the carrier board follows Micro ATX 9.6 x 8 inch (243.84mm x
203.2mm) specification. The back panel jacks may not conform to ATX specifications.
